A new electrophoretic system, able to separate all the known standard glycosaminoglycans, was investigated as a method for the study of glycosaminoglycans extracted from tumours of the central nervous system. Densitometric analysis of standard glycosaminoglycan electrophoresis revealed high sesitivity and good repeatability. The electrophoretic system applied to biological samples based on a comigration of extracted glycosaminoglycans with standards, allowed subfractioning of chondroitinsulfates, dermatan sulfate and herapan sulfate and identifaction of heparan sulfate and heparin directly on the sheet by treatment with nitrous acid. Such characters permit the analysis of glycosaminoglycans present in small amount in biological samples.
